  A coalition of cities and counties in blue states have sued the Trump administration over alleged threats and "illegal targeting" of sanctuary cities.

The article from WTVR CBS 6 discusses a lawsuit filed by the City of Richmond, Virginia, against the Trump administration. The lawsuit challenges an executive order by President Trump that aims to withhold federal funding from so-called "sanctuary cities" — cities that limit cooperation with federal immigration enforcement. The contention is that this executive order is unconstitutional and overreaches federal authority, as it attempts to coerce local governments into enforcing federal immigration laws. Richmond, along with other cities, argues that the order infringes on local autonomy and violates the 10th Amendment by imposing conditions on federal grants that are not explicitly authorized by Congress. The lawsuit seeks to block the enforcement of this executive order, arguing that it threatens the city's ability to provide essential services due to potential loss of federal funds.
